Lion Road is a residential street with 76 addresses.
It ranks as the 173rd largest and 104th most expensive of the 221 streets in the TW1 area. The dominant property type is a period house built between 1800 and 1911.
The street contains a total of 76 properties: 63 houses and 13 flats.
Sale prices range from £234,936 for 1 bedroom leasehold flats (318 ft2) to £2,552,075 for 5 bedroom freehold houses with a garden (2,561 ft2) .
Monthly rental prices range from £1,181 pcm for 1 bed flats to £6,850 pcm for 5 bed houses.
The gross rental yield is between 3.2% and 6.1%.
The average value per square foot is £781.
The last sale on Lion Road sold for £572,000 on 21st November 2025. Since then prices are up an average of 1.3%.
The current average value in the street is £741,020.
The Lion Road Sales Market has increased by 11.1% over the last 10 years.

The last sale was on 21st November 2025 for £572,000 and since then the market in the area has increased by 1.3%. The street has had a total of 153 sales since 1995.
Lion Road, Twickenham, TW1 has seen 8 sales in the last three years and 3 sales in the last twelve months.
Lion Road, Twickenham, TW1 is the 173rd largest and the 104th most expensive street in the TW1 area.
There are 3 postcodes on Lion Road, Twickenham, TW1.
The closest station to Lion Road, Twickenham, TW1 is Twickenham station which is 600 metres away.
